Milan, Italy, this city was famous worldwide for its fashion. But in the hearts of the football fans, the city had nothing to do with fashion. There was only one reason why the city’s name could be known around the world—football.
The word “derby” in the sports world was first used in horse racing, but it was football that carried it forward all over the world. There were many wonderful classic “derbies” in the football world, but no derby was more attention grabbing than a same city derby.
In Spain, the El Clásico between Real Madrid and Barcelona might shining bright, but in the minds of the players and fans, the real derbies were The Madrid Derby between Real Madrid and Atlético Madrid and the Derbi barceloní between Barcelona and RCD Espanyol. The same city derby was always the most eye-catching match, such as the most intense city derby in the world—the “Old Firm” of Glasgow, Scotland.
It was no exaggeration to say that “the derby created football.” For football without a competition like a derby and dominated by antagonistic and hateful sentiment, perhaps it would not have developed as far as it had today—that state of mind would have been like a catalyst.
Milan in Italy also had the same kind of city derby, which was one of the few cities where these two world-class powerhouse clubs existed. The powerhouse clubs, AC Milan and Inter Milan had long been spread around the world with their respective brilliant achievements.
AC Milan had an era of three musketeers and Inter Milan had its own dominated era. Both teams were not weaker than which. Sometimes the east wind toppled the west wind, and sometimes the west wind overpowered the east wind.
